Q&A

What fence material lasts longest in Trenton's soil?

Material compatibility is critical. Trenton has moderate soil corrosivity and a moderate termite risk. Pressure-treated pine posts are standard, but all metal fasteners and hardware must be G90 galvanized steel or better to prevent rust streaks and premature failure. Composite or metal panels offer superior resistance to both decay and insect damage.

What needs to happen before you dig the first post hole?

State law requires a MISS DIG 811 utility locate request at least 3 business days before excavation. Hitting a buried gas, electric, or fiber line in Downtown Trenton results in major repair costs, service outages, and liability. A professional installer manages this ticket and pulls any required city permit, ensuring the project clears the permit office before mobilization.

Is a standard fence strong enough for Trenton's wind?

A design wind speed of 115 MPH V-ult governs structural calculations per ASCE 7-22 standards. This rating dictates post spacing, concrete footing diameter, and the required strength of post-to-rail brackets. A non-engineered fence built for 90 MPH winds will likely fail during peak storm season gusts, especially in exposed areas near I-75.

What are the height and setback rules for a fence in my yard?

Trenton zoning limits fences to 3 feet in front yards and 6 feet in rear/side yards. The city allows a 0-foot setback, meaning you can build directly on your property line. For corner lots, especially those near I-75, visibility 'sight triangles' at intersections prohibit obstructions over 3 feet tall within 25 feet of the curb.

Can I install an automatic gate for my pool area?

Yes, but the gate system must integrate with pool safety codes. Under IRC Appendix AG (2015 Michigan Residential Code), any gate providing access to a pool must be self-closing and self-latching. Modern smart-gate IoT systems can provide remote operation while ensuring the latch automatically engages to the required height, meeting both security and liability standards.

How deep should my fence posts be set in Downtown Trenton?

Fence posts in Downtown Trenton require a minimum 42-inch footing depth to extend below the local frost line. Posts set in shallow footings will heave upwards during winter freeze-thaw cycles, causing immediate structural failure and permanent misalignment. The 2021 International Residential Code (IRC) R403.1.4 mandates this depth for structural stability.

Am I required to notify my neighbor before building a fence on the property line?

Yes. Under the Michigan Fence Act (MCL 43.51), a 'partition fence' on a shared boundary is a shared responsibility. Current Trenton practice requires written notification to the adjoining property owner before construction or replacement begins. This 2026 legal standard prevents disputes and establishes liability for future maintenance.
